Tile Roof Installation Cost Range in Woodland Hills, CA
Typical price ranges for tile roof installation in Woodland Hills, CA, can vary based on project scope and material choices. Below are general estimates to help compare options and plan budgets.
$10,000 - $20,000 for standard residential tile roof installations
$20,000 - $35,000 for larger or more complex projects
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Residential Roof | $10,000 - $15,000 |
| Mid-Size Home | $15,000 - $25,000 |
| Large Home or Custom Design | $25,000 - $35,000 |
| Re-roofing Existing Tile | $12,000 - $22,000 |
| New Construction | $20,000 - $30,000 |
| Complex or Multi-Story Roof | $30,000 - $45,000 |
| Tile Material Upgrade | $2,000 - $5,000 additional |
What affects the cost of tile roof installation
Understanding the factors that influence tile roof installation costs can help in planning and comparing options. Several elements can impact the overall expense of a project in Woodland Hills, CA.
- Materials: The choice of tile type, such as clay, concrete, or slate, affects material costs and availability in the local market.
- Size and scope: Larger roofs or those with complex layouts typically require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
- Labor complexity: Roofs with steep pitches, multiple levels, or intricate designs may require specialized skills and more time to install.
- Permitting: Local building permits and inspections in Woodland Hills can add to project expenses and timelines.
- Extras: Additional features such as skylights, ventilation systems, or decorative elements can influence the total project cost.
